[QUOTE="Corbic, post: 278475, member: 10079"] Alright, I currently own a '96 GT which I picked up for $2,400. It's not perfect, but its a second car and has been rather fun so far. Car currently needs shocks (riding on springs) and an exhaust (holes in each muffler), not to mention it runs rich (mmm the smell of noxious gas). Oh yeah, A/C is toast. Paint is pealing in various spots, it has an after market sunroof, missing a truck "damper" (won't stay open), cracked bumper, cracked and fogged head lights, busted passenger mirror, and a dent in the passenger door and right in front of the "rear brake air-duct". I own a set of 16s (as shown) and 2001 17's for the Car. [img]http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v242/Corbic/DSC_1293.jpg?t=1199320617[/img] Isn't she wonderful? (God I hate the white :santa_undecided:) Ok here is the plan! I'd like the car to see more track use and swapping the NPI Intake nearly killed me so PI swap and Cams are out. I may feel gritty enough to swap a full PI engine or even a DOHC.. but that seems cost prohibitive. Exhaust Manifolds (short) Catted Mid-Pipe Cat-Back MM Steering Rack Bushings (Aluminum) Rear Seat Delete CAI (most likely K&N) Suspension I'm undecided. I could piece meal it using sub-frames, Ford Suspension Package (Mach1/Bullit) and some Caster/Camber Plates, or I could just go with the Maximum Motorsports Sport Box for $1,500 ( :santa_undecided:) although the Panhard Bar install looks rather difficult. [img]http://www.maximummotorsports.com/store/images/packgd_sys/SB-2.jpg[/img] Then Fiber Glass or Carbon Fiber Hood (Cobra R style maybe) Carbon Fiber Trunk Lid Rear Gears Aluminum Drive Shaft IDK, maybe a MM Steering Shaft as well... Lastly some Yonaka Seats [img]http://i17.ebayimg.com/01/i/000/b1/d4/ced9_1.JPG[/img] Am I on the right path? Goals, reduce some of the numbness the car has, improve steering response, see some power and throttle response increases. Dial out the under steer, increase over steer.. [/QUOTE]
